EXCERPT

Chapter One

Bobbi Jo Martin hung back in the shadows under the Highway Thirty-Seven Racetrack stands. Acrid smoke, fumes and dust from a long night of racing swirled in the hazy light but couldn’t entirely block her view of her childhood best friend. There he was, Jack Day, strutting toward a red pickup with a buxom brunette hanging on each arm. She cringed—they must be the spoils that went to the winner of the feature race.

Deflated, Bobbi Jo shuffled toward her rental car. She’d had no contact with Jack for nearly ten years, but she just knew he’d help her with her current problem. When they were kids, he had never, ever let her down. She glanced one last time at the two women scrambling into the pickup. A solution would have to wait.

Her skin chilled, then suddenly turned hot. She needed him, damn it. She slid behind the wheel of the car, started the engine and rested her head on the steering wheel.

Bobbi Jo had a surprise for Jack—but would he welcome it? He had to relieve her of her virginity. Her childhood sweetheart had to teach her how to be a captivating lover—and there wasn’t much time. Two weeks from tonight would be her wedding night, and she had to be skilled at lovemaking by then.

She banged her fist against the steering wheel. Why did he have to be involved with those two women tonight, of all nights? She’d hoped to set up a chance meeting in a public place. Now she’d have to go directly to him.

Would he want her? Goosebumps pebbled her arms. She couldn’t let him reject her. He had what she wanted.

EXCERPT

Set Up: Having checked out the Center’s website from Rosanne’s business card, the detective has decided to drop in on a lecture at a college campus… 

New York, New York 2014

Sitting in the back row of the small lecture hall, Tom Walker had a difficult time believing that the conservatively dressed, articulate, non-threatening woman explaining the hazards of sexually transmitted diseases was the same provocative woman he’d confronted at the rest area parking lot.

The hall was half-filled, with possibly two thirds of the audience female. Initially it had held a distinct air of tension, but Rosanne Falcon’s quick wit and sense of humor had helped relax the mood of the crowd. Clearly, Falcon and her co-presenter, Anna Jackson, were quite experienced at working a crowd. Jackson, with a nursing background, had been reassuring about how women and men could protect themselves and obtain treatment if they failed to do so. She came across very matter-of-fact, almost motherly.

He figured Jackson had to be in her forties. Taller than Falcon, the brunette was somewhat larger in build—not overweight, but leaning that way a little. She looked like money. The rings on her fingers reflected in the light, and he knew enough about women’s fashion to be aware the pantsuit she wore was probably tailored. All in all, pleasant looking, and knew how to dress for her size.

But Anna Jackson didn’t catch his imagination like Rosanne Falcon did. Hardly anything about Rosanne’s simple one-piece blue dress was sexy, yet she was the sexiest woman in the room. Was it her poise? It wasn’t her oversized loop earrings. Maybe it was her confident smile. She knew she had everyone’s attention.

Even his presence had only caused a momentary blip. He’d purposely come into the hall after he heard her begin to introduce herself and Anna. She hadn’t appeared shocked when he took his seat. By then she was already on cruise control. She had no doubt put him aside as a problem to deal with later.

Along with everyone else, he’d laughed when she’d informed them that the slide presentation was PG rated; if they’d been expecting X-rated materials, they’d be disappointed. She and Jackson shared several slides loaded with data on sexually transmitted diseases, including HIV. There’d been a brief overview of the Center and its mission with a few slides of staff sitting around tables and working at computers. A couple slides of instructional DVD covers were at least suggestive. The slide that brought the biggest gasp of surprise, then titters and whispers, showed a table with a vast array of sex toys.

Clearly amused by the audience’s response, Falcon had quipped, “Don’t laugh. Some of those can be a woman or man’s second-best friend. Ladies, how many of you own at least one vibrator?”

A few hands went up, then many more. She’d laughed and clapped her hands. “Our research data suggests that the percentage is probably a little higher than that. Sorry if I embarrassed anyone.”

EXCERPT

Set Up: Rosanne has shared her concern about the detective’s investigation with the Center staff.

New York, New York 2014

“I don’t care what you say,” Center Co-Director Harry Gage grumbled, “I don’t like the idea of a cop nosing around. Nothing good comes from that.”

Melissa Hopkins-Gage, the other co-director, shook her head at her husband, who sat on the opposite side of the office round table, with Simone Stone and Rosanne on either side of her. She knew he was only expressing his concern for their staff.

She was pleased that Anna Jackson, the Center’s part-time community education director and board member, had been able to join them this morning. In her early forties, Anna brought a certain wisdom to the Center as well as strong commitment to the Center’s broad educational mission. That she probably colored her raven hair and that her body had matured with age, displaying a slightly thicker waist and wider hips than Anna preferred, made her an asset, particularly in fantasy videos depicting a middle-aged woman’s role. Her enthusiasm in front of the camera rivaled that of her younger colleagues.

“We don’t have anything to hide, Harry,” Melissa reminded her husband. “You know that.”

Melissa glanced at Rosanne, who was uncharacteristically antsy. She’d seldom seen her friend so out of sorts. This detective must’ve shaken her up more than she was admitting. “If your detective comes to the Center, we’ll show him around. If he thinks we’re trying to hide something, then he’ll probably hang around a lot longer.”

Rosanne nodded, looking less than convinced.

“I haven’t liked this damn project you two are working on from the beginning.” Harry raked his graying hair. “It’s not safe. And it makes you look like…”

“Harry,” Rosanne interrupted, “we’ve discussed this ad nauseum. Simone and I are careful. We back each other up. We’ve nearly completed our sample selection. Simone’s already finished with her part of the data collection.”

“Right,” Harry huffed. “Because Boyd finally put his foot down. At least her husband has some sense.”

Simone thrust out her chin defiantly. “I agreed to quit because I didn’t have any more data to gain. My preliminary analysis suggests we’re developing a fairly complete picture of the trucker who seeks a liaison while on the road. Don’t make it sound like Boyd has me on a leash.”

Melissa smiled at the spunky woman, who was only two years older than Rosanne. Both women had their doctorates. Both were avid advocates for the Center and its mission. And both could twist Harry Gage around their fingers. She should know. She’d been doing that since before they married. “You know they’re not going to be satisfied until their research is done, Harry. If things were reversed, you’d feel just as strongly.”

Giving up, Harry scrunched his mouth. “That doesn’t mean I have to like it.”

“No, I suppose it doesn’t. So,” Melissa said, taking charge, “if this detective shows up, we’ll be nice to him, answer his questions, and show him around.”

“You won’t show him around,” Rosanne protested, “if we’re working on camera.”

“Of course not,” Melissa agreed. “We can show him the stages and sets when they’re not in use, which is most of the time. Do you really think he’ll track you down?”

Rosanne took a long time to respond.

Melissa knew Max’s granddaughter better than most. That flicker of emotion wasn’t exactly fear. So she was more than a little curious about the man who’d apparently stalked her from the rest area to the rental car agency. Melissa smiled to herself. She’d tuck that bit of information away, just in case.

Rosanne flexed her fingers and wet her lips. “I’ll be surprised if he doesn’t,” she said at last. “Detective Walker strikes me as a man who won’t be satisfied until he has all the pieces of the puzzle in place.”

“And you’re his puzzle for the moment.”
